Interferon‐Driven Biomarkers and Synergistic Therapy for PRMT5 Inhibition in Triple‐Negative Breast Cancer

open access: yesAdvanced Science, EarlyView.
Triple‐negative breast cancer exhibits variable sensitivity to PRMT5 inhibition. Basal interferon signaling is identified as a key biomarker of response. PARP inhibition with olaparib induces IFN signaling, sensitizing resistant TNBC cells to PRMT5 inhibitors.

2‐line Ferrihydrite Enhance Microbial Synthesis of Plant Biostimulants in Composted Biosolid by Regulating Phyla Pseudomonadota and Actinomycetota

open access: yesAdvanced Science, EarlyView.
This study explores how iron and manganese oxides transform sewage sludge into plant biostimulants during composting. Non‐targeted identification reveals the main species of plant biostimulants. Metagenomic analysis reveals that 2‐line ferrihydrite specifically enriches microbial genes for biosynthesis, boosting plant‐growth promoters.

PD‐1 Inhibits CD4+ TRM‐Mediated cDC1 Mobilization via Suppressing JAML in Human NSCLC

open access: yesAdvanced Science, EarlyView.
CD4+ tissue‐resident memory T cells (TRMs) in non‐small cell lung cancer recruit conventional type 1 dendritic cells via XCL1‐XCR1 signaling, orchestrating antitumor immunity.
